是否可以隐藏URL跟踪?

问题描述:

问题很简单,我有一个网站www.mydomain.com其他链接到其他网页(在同一网站),如www.mydomain.com/some/directory/some_page.asp。我想知道是否可以隐藏第二部分,并只显示www.mydomain.com。 我正在使用DotNetNuke,IIS Web服务器。 是否有可能通过url_rewrite模块做到这一点?是否可以隐藏URL跟踪?

+0

如果您确切的要求是_“我希望浏览器的地址栏始终显示”www.mydomain.com“和那个确切的URI”_“,然后使用iframe。你不想要这个。 – CodeCaster

你想让所有的URL在浏览器中只显示域名吗?做到这一点的唯一方法是使用Iframe,这是一个可怕的想法。这意味着没有人可以复制和粘贴您的网址发送给他们的朋友,并且如果他们只是获取URL,因为他们知道如何使用浏览器,用户将会看到完整的路径。

url_rewrite模块不会做你以后的事情。它可以将一个URL重写为另一个,例如而不是www.mydomain.com/mypage.asp你可以有www.mydomain.com/mypage。但是,您无法将所有页面映射到根域(想想看,它如何知道要为该URL提供哪些页面)。

这是人们过去在90年代要求的东西。那么这是一个糟糕的主意,现在这是一个更糟糕的想法。